From mboxrd@z Thu Jan 1 00:00:00 1970 From: Romain Naour Date: Sun, 6 Dec 2020 18:35:37 +0100 Subject: [Buildroot] [PATCHv5 5/5] package/bcc: add optional luajit dependency In-Reply-To: <20201206173537.1397691-1-romain.naour@gmail.com> References: <20201206173537.1397691-1-romain.naour@gmail.com> Message-ID: <20201206173537.1397691-5-romain.naour@gmail.com>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net Signed-off-by: Romain Naour Cc: Qais Yousef --- package/bcc/bcc.mk |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/package/bcc/bcc.mk b/package/bcc/bcc.mk index bafa9e2096..8b6ba63f90 100644 --- a/package/bcc/bcc.mk +++ b/package/bcc/bcc.mk @@ -19,8 +19,14 @@ BCC_DEPENDENCIES = host-bison host-flex clang elfutils flex llvm python3 tar BCC_CONF_OPTS = -DENABLE_LLVM_SHARED=ON \ -DREVISION=$(BCC_VERSION) \ -DENABLE_CLANG_JIT=ON \ - -DENABLE_MAN=OFF \ - -DENABLE_LUAJIT=OFF + -DENABLE_MAN=OFF + +ifeq ($(BR2_PACKAGE_LUAJIT),y) +BCC_DEPENDENCIES += luajit +BCC_CONF_OPTS += -DENABLE_LUAJIT=ON +else +BCC_CONF_OPTS += -DENABLE_LUAJIT=OFF +endif define BCC_LINUX_CONFIG_FIXUPS # Enable kernel support for eBPF -- 2.25.4